构建高性能网站架构:深入了解WEB技术

需积分: 14 3 下载量 53 浏览量 更新于2024-07-27 收藏 4.14MB PDF 举报
"高并发web架构" 高并发web架构是指在高流量和高并发的网络环境下,通过合理的架构设计和技术实现,确保网站或应用程序能够稳定运行、快速响应和高效处理大量用户请求的能力。以下是高并发web架构的相关知识点: 1. 负载均衡技术:负载均衡是高并发web架构的核心技术之一,它可以将用户请求分配到多个服务器上,以便提高网站的响应速度和处理能力。常见的负载均衡技术包括IP Hash、URL Hash、随机算法等。 2. 缓存技术:缓存技术是高并发web架构中另一个重要的技术,它可以将常用的数据或计算结果暂时存储在缓存中,以便快速响应用户请求。常见的缓存技术包括浏览器缓存、服务器缓存、分布式缓存等。 3. 数据库优化技术:数据库优化是高并发web架构中不可或缺的一部分,它可以通过优化数据库结构、索引和查询语句来提高数据库的处理能力。常见的数据库优化技术包括数据库分区、数据索引、查询优化等。 4. Web服务器优化技术:Web服务器优化是高并发web架构中另一个重要的技术,它可以通过优化Web服务器的配置、缓存和并发处理能力来提高网站的响应速度。常见的Web服务器优化技术包括Apache优化、Nginx优化、IIS优化等。 5. 分布式架构技术:分布式架构是高并发web架构中的一种常见的技术,它可以将网站或应用程序分布到多个服务器上,以便提高网站的处理能力和可用性。常见的分布式架构技术包括微服务架构、SOA架构、云计算架构等。 6. 高性能网络技术:高性能网络技术是高并发web架构中的一种重要的技术,它可以通过优化网络架构和协议来提高网站的响应速度和处理能力。常见的高性能网络技术包括CDN技术、负载均衡技术、网络协议优化等。 7. 云计算技术:云计算技术是高并发web架构中的一种常见的技术,它可以将网站或应用程序部署到云平台上,以便提高网站的处理能力和可用性。常见的云计算技术包括公有云、私有云、混合云等。 8. 大数据技术:大数据技术是高并发web架构中的一种重要的技术,它可以通过处理和分析大量数据来提高网站的智能化和个性化。常见的大数据技术包括Hadoop技术、Spark技术、NoSQL技术等。 9. 安全技术:安全技术是高并发web架构中的一种不可或缺的技术,它可以通过加密、认证和访问控制来保护网站和用户的数据。常见的安全技术包括SSL技术、HTTPS技术、身份验证技术等。 10. 监控和优化技术:监控和优化技术是高并发web架构中的一种重要的技术,它可以通过监控网站的性能和响应速度来优化网站的架构和配置。常见的监控和优化技术包括APM技术、监控系统技术、性能优化技术等。 高并发web架构是通过合理的架构设计和技术实现来确保网站或应用程序能够稳定运行、快速响应和高效处理大量用户请求的能力。通过了解和掌握这些技术,可以帮助开发者更好地设计和实现高并发web架构。